Literacy is at the core of all that we do in LSSD and our approach is guided by Manitoba curriculum outcomes.   We believe that strong literacy skills will open doors for future and lifelong learning.  Our goal is to ensure that every student becomes a confident reader, writer, listener and communicator who can think critically and express their ideas effectively.  We recognize that literacy development is a shared responsibility and our staff work collaboratively with families, support staff and community partners to create rich literacy environments both in and beyond the classroom.  

Teachers use a comprehensive literacy framework, recognizing that there is no one size fits all approach to teaching students to read and write.  Providing students with effective daily classroom instruction, rich learning experiences, access to diverse texts, multiple access points and targeted interventions all help students reach their full potential. 

Through continuous assessment and ongoing professional learning, we strive to build a culture where every student sees themselves as a capable and engaged reader and writer.
